Generator Hookup Service in Denver County, CO
Generator hookup services involve connecting a backup power generator to a property’s electrical system to ensure reliable electricity during outages. These projects typically include installing transfer switches, wiring the generator to the home’s electrical panel, and ensuring proper integration with existing electrical systems. Homeowners often request this service when preparing for storm seasons, power outages, or to meet specific energy needs, and they usually want to understand the scope of work, compatibility with their current electrical setup, and any necessary permits or inspections before proceeding.
Property owners should consider the size and type of generator suitable for their home, as well as the electrical requirements of their appliances and systems. It’s important to clarify whether the installation will include a permanent or portable generator, and to understand the process for connecting to existing utility power safely. Additionally, knowing the local codes and regulations that may affect the installation can help ensure a smooth and compliant setup. Common Generator Hookup Service Jobs
Generator hookup services - professional installation of transfer switches and electrical connections for home generators.
Emergency generator connections - wiring services to ensure reliable backup power during outages.
Whole-home generator hookups - integrating generators seamlessly with existing electrical systems for full home coverage.
Portable generator connections - safe and secure wiring setups for portable units used in emergencies.
Generator transfer switch installation - installing switches that allow quick switching between utility power and backup generators.
Generator service upgrades - enhancing electrical panels to support generator connections safely.
Generator Hookup Service Questions
What is a generator hookup service? It involves installing and connecting a backup generator to a property’s electrical system for reliable power during outages.
What types of generators can be connected? Both portable and standby generators can be integrated with existing electrical systems to ensure continuous power supply.
Is electrical work required for generator hookup? Yes, professional electrical connections are necessary to safely connect the generator to the property's electrical system.
What should property owners consider before a generator installation? It's important to assess power needs, available space, and ensure proper placement for safe and effective operation.
